San Francisco 49ers RB Christian McCaffrey (calf, Achilles) continues to deal with the unpredictability of Achilles tendinitis, according to general manager John Lynch, who admitted not knowing if the running back will play in Week 2 against the Minnesota Vikings.
‘Don’t know that. He’s dealing with this Achilles tendinitis. It’s one of those deals that can be feeling good one day, and then the next day it flares…. Primary in our mind is the long view. He changes us, he makes us different. but it’s also nice to see that we can function without him,’ Lynch said.
